Player Notes
December 5, 2006
Michel Ouellet has been cleared by doctors to return to game action, according to the Post-Gazette. It isn't known if Ouellet, who has been out since Nov. 22 with a shoulder injury, will be back in the lineup tonight or not.
November 21, 2006
Michel Ouellet was scratched last night because of leg injuries, according to the Post-Gazette. Ouellet said his injury, which began in a knee but is more focused on the hamstring now, is as a result of a hit he took in Saturday's game. He said he was "day-to-day," choosing not to set a timetable for his return.
March 8, 2006
Michel Ouellet did not play on Wednesday against the Capitals after taking a stick to the mouth on Tuesday, according to the AP.
March 7, 2006
Michel Ouellet left the ice after taking a stick to the mouth during Tuesday's game. Ouellet lost at least one tooth in the incident.
February 11, 2006
Michel Ouellet likely will not return from his bruised right knee for Saturday's game, according to the Pittsburgh Post-Gazette.
February 10, 2006
The Pittsburgh Post-Gazette reports that Michel Ouellet will not play tonight because of his bruised right knee.
February 9, 2006
Michel Ouellet was unable to play Wednesday after sustaining a badly bruised right knee during Monday's game, according to the Pittsburgh Post-Gazette.
February 7, 2006
Michel Ouellet injured his right knee Monday when he fell heavily into the boards early in the third period after he was checked by Chris Phillips, according to the AP. "The doctor said it's probably not something major," said Ouellet. "At least I can walk on it a little bit, so that's a good thing."
